CustomProperty Class
A custom property for a report, report item, or group. This class cannot be inherited.
Inheritance Hierarchy
System.Object
Microsoft.ReportingServices.ReportRendering.CustomProperty
Namespace: Microsoft.ReportingServices.ReportRendering
Assembly: Microsoft.ReportingServices.ProcessingCore (in Microsoft.ReportingServices.ProcessingCore.dll)

Remarks
An expression-based Name or Value that is contained within a CustomData object with no data evaluates to nulla null reference (Nothing in Visual Basic).
Custom properties with expressions that need to be evaluated even when there are no rows should be placed in the CustomReportItem.
